HVAC repair costs vary based on the specific mechanical failure, the age of your equipment, and whether specific parts need to be sourced. If a technician finds an issue with a refrigerant leak, a failed capacitor, or a faulty blower motor, the labor time and material cost will shift accordingly. Gas furnace repair for Richmond homes involves a licensed professional inspecting critical components like the igniter, gas valve, burners, and heat exchanger for proper function and safety. They will also assess the flue system for adequate ventilation and check the blower motor for correct airflow.
